It is becoming increasingly important to have a strong online presence. This begins with having a good-quality website, yet many businesses usually underestimate how strategic (and complex) the website development process can be. The website development life cycle consists of several key development phases, each essential for planning, project management, and timeline tracking. Every step plays a crucial role in the final user’s experience and thus affects how effectively your company and its values are represented.
We’ll walk through each stage of the website development process, explaining why each step matters and how the Big Red Jelly’s proven process ensures better outcomes. Effective project management is crucial to ensure each phase is executed efficiently and deadlines are met.
By following a structured process throughout the website development life cycle, you can achieve successful website development that meets your business goals.
Brand
1. Understand Your Business
It’s essential to understand what defines our brand identity and what our value proposition is. This is the foundation of the web development process to ensure that your business, and by extension your website, accurately represents your business and effectively communicates it’s value. Think of it as answering the following questions:
- How do I want my users to perceive my brand? (premium / accessible, innovative / reliable, etc..)
- What problem does my company solve for my customers ?
- Why should a client choose my product over other ones on the market?
By answering these questions you’ll have a clear understanding of what your brand represents and why it matters to customers. Identifying your target audience is a key step in the website development process, as it ensures your content and design are tailored to the specific needs and preferences of those you want to reach, which leads us to our next step: understanding who those customers actually are.
2. Understand your Audience
The final goal of our website is to solve our users’ inquiries and allow them to perform tasks that they specifically would want to complete (Eg: purchase a product), and we can design a process that feels easy and intuitive if we know who our user is. When tailoring the website for your audience, it is crucial to consider user experience aspects to ensure the site is engaging and meets their needs.
Understanding your real users’ goals, behaviors and pain points gives us a direction: what to build and what problems to solve for them.
Ask yourself this question, if you were building a physical store, would you design it the same way for young children, gym enthusiasts or business executives ? Of course not. the same principle applies to websites, knowing your audience shapes every decision.
3. Build Your Visual Identity
We, as humans are highly visual beings, our ability to recognize patterns and match colors with emotions is the reason why we remember brands through visual cues. In this step we will define the following
- Color palette
- Typography
- Common patterns (Shapes and forms)
- User interface elements (such as buttons, menus, and navigation) to ensure a cohesive and intuitive website experience.
A consistent visual identity will help your users recognize and understand your brand immediately. Even before they read a single word.
Content
We’ve already established that, as humans, we are highly visual. However, our website still needs actual precise and concise information to reliably communicate your value. An important truth to remember is that most users don’t read, they scan. They are on your website for a mission, looking for the specific information that they need. High-quality website content is essential for engaging users and supporting SEO, ensuring your site performs well in search rankings and keeps visitors interested.
At this stage in the website design and development process, the focus is crafting relevant content that has a clear purpose for our website. Web content is structured and managed to align with user needs, making sure information is accessible and easy to navigate. The visuals and interactive elements should also guide the user to this purpose without overwhelming them.
Our proven process writes strategically by focusing on Information hierarchy using headings, bullet points, and other assets to guide the attention to what matters the most, with content creation as a strategic process for developing effective website messaging.
Building: Bringing the Strategy to Life
This is the stage where all the planning takes shape and becomes reality. The development team is responsible for executing, coding, testing, and managing the entire website build, ensuring collaboration across all phases. Design and development work together to create a website that’s not only visually appealing but also functional, fast, and scalable. Allocating the right development resources is essential to align team members and stakeholders, ensuring a smooth and successful process.
1. Map the Customer Journey and User Experience
At this point we know very well who our users are and what goals they want to achieve on our website, we then have to map out how the users will navigate through our website to achieve this goal. This will define which pages and features are required. Creating comprehensive site maps at this stage helps visualize the website’s structure and navigation flow, providing a clear blueprint for organizing content and planning the user journey.
For example, a travel company might need a search flow and steps that let the user book a flight, while an e-commerce company might have a clear and easy purchase process.
2. Build a Strategic Sitemap
The sitemap serves as the blueprint for your website, outlining how pages are structured and how users can move between them. A well-planned site architecture is essential for organizing website content and navigation, ensuring both users and search engines can easily find information. The objective is to define a clear path to guide the user through the customer journey. This will also make the website easier to find by search engines.
Think of it like designing the layout of a house. You have already defined what rooms you need; now you are deciding how to connect them. At this stage, it’s important to identify and create page templates, and define each page template, to ensure a consistent layout and functionality across the website.
3. Website Development
This is the step where the website itself comes to life. The development phase is where writing code and web programming bring the website to life, using html css and javascript, hypertext markup language, and cascading style sheets as foundational technologies. There are several approaches to website development, each suited to different business needs:
- Custom Code (HTML, CSS, JavaScript): Offers full flexibility and scalability, ideal for complex or high-performance sites. This approach involves choosing the right programming language, utilizing various programming languages, and often includes server side languages for back end development, ensuring the site can handle advanced features and integrations.
- Content Management Systems (CMS) like WordPress: Balance customization and ease of use, allowing marketing teams to update content without developer support.
- No-Code/Low-Code Builders (Webflow, Squarespace): Provide speed and simplicity, often best for startups or small businesses with limited budgets.
- The development process involves backend developers who handle server-side logic and integrations, front end developers focus on user interface and experience, full stack developer and full stack developers who manage both front-end and back-end tasks, and web developer and web developers who ensure the technical aspects and functionality of the site.
Development tools, file transfer protocol, and a content management system are essential for building, deploying, and managing the website efficiently.
Database management and seamless integration of systems and data sources are crucial for robust website functionality.
A deep understanding of technical aspects is required throughout the development life cycle and development phases of any web development project or website development project.
The entire project is managed as a development project, with multiple development projects and web development projects often running in parallel to meet business goals.
The goal is to deliver a final product and launch a new website composed of multiple web pages, with each web page carefully crafted for performance and usability.
Maintaining websites and post launch maintenance are ongoing responsibilities to ensure long-term success and stability.
A website development checklist is used to ensure all steps are completed and nothing is overlooked during the process.
4. Testing and Launch
Before going live, your website should go through a testing phase to review design, usability, and responsiveness across different screen sizes. Quality assurance is essential during this phase to ensure the website meets performance and usability standards. Additionally, validating your website’s code against current web standards is important to guarantee browser compatibility and proper functionality across different platforms.
Launching isn’t the final step, it’s the beginning. Before going live, make sure to address search engine optimization to improve your website’s visibility in search results. Ongoing monitoring and audits keep your website performing optimally.
Strategy
The Strategy phase is data-driven. We don’t guess what works; we use smart measurements and analysis to make sure the website meets the goals we previously defined. We leverage marketing tools to track and optimize website performance, ensuring that every aspect is aligned with our objectives. Tracking the users’ experience on our website helps us identify pain points more easily.
For example, high bounce rates on a specific page may signify misleading content, while users taking too long in a process means that the flow is too complex. Having these insights allows us to quickly identify what tasks to prioritize based on the best feedback there is: our real users’ experience.
Grow
The Grow phase is the ultimate goal of our website and our company: to achieve sustained business growth. It involves continuously applying the insights we gather in the Strategy phase and using modern tools at our disposal to optimize results. Leveraging relevant online resources is also essential to support ongoing website growth and ensure we are utilizing the best digital tools and content for our target audience. Our efforts focus on the following areas:
- Accessibility & Speed: Having a fast, lightweight website that users can navigate across any device—cellphones, tablets, and computers—will help reduce friction and therefore help our users navigate through their customer journey.
- SEO & Content: Creating and optimizing quality content is an organic way to tell search engines that our website is valuable to its users, which will help the website improve its visibility.
- SEM & Ads: To drive traffic where it is most appropriate.
Conclusion:
Developing a website is much more than following a guide or checklist — it’s about understanding your business and audience, and crafting a digital tool that solves their inquiries and problems.
Each phase, from planning to building, is equally important. Skipping or rushing through these steps can lead to rework or a suboptimal website.
At Big Red Jelly, we’ve perfected these steps through our proven process, which guarantees not only a high-quality website but also measurable business growth. Get in touch with our team today!






